    About INGRID JENSEN Born in Vancouver and raised in Nanaimo, B.C., Ingrid Jensen has been hailed as one of the most gifted trumpeters of her generation.     Edmar Castañeda Edmar Castañeda is a virtuoso folk harpist hailing from Bogatá, Colombia. He performs his own compositions as well as tapping into native music of Colombia and Venezuela.     Theo Walentiny Theo Walentiny is a New Jersey born pianist, composer and improviser.     Samara Joy Samara Joy is still relatively new to jazz. Growing up in the Bronx, it was music of the past — the music of her parent’s childhoods, as she put it — that she listened to most.     Coleman Hughes Coleman Hughes is an American writer and podcast host. He was a fellow at the Manhattan Institute for Policy Research and a fellow and contributing editor at their City Journal, and is the host of the podcast Conversations with Coleman.
